The Immediate Vicinity

The immediate environment offers little in terms of practical convenience, with no retail stores, food outlets, or markets within the 150-meter radius. Residents would need to plan ahead or use a vehicle for even the most basic errands, limiting spontaneous outings for essentials like groceries or meals. There is no organic daily rhythm to this space, making it more isolated in function.

The atmosphere is quiet and sparse, with very little street-level activity to shape the character of the surroundings. Without the presence of shops or people moving through the area, the street feels subdued and residential, with a sense of stillness that defines the daily experience. It is a private setting, though one that leans on external connections for vitality.

Walking Distance Lifestyle

This setting leans into a semi-rural character, with multiple parks and green spaces dominating the landscape. The low neighbor count and lack of commercial facilities create a serene, open atmosphere, ideal for those seeking distance from urban density. While the presence of parks adds recreational value, the absence of retail or transit infrastructure underscores its current developmental stage.

Infrastructure is heavily centered on natural spaces rather than daily necessities. Parks are abundant, but there are no grocery stores, restaurants, or public transport stops within walking distance. Residents will need to drive for basic amenities, aligning this area more with a weekend retreat than a self-sustaining daily lifestyle.

District Connectivity

This area is supported by a network of major hypermarkets — Tops, Big C, and multiple Lotus’s branches — providing reliable retail access within a short drive. The presence of one hospital, two schools, and twenty parks suggests a functional layout for families. Pier 6 is a notable transit point nearby, offering a waterway option for city travel. However, the absence of major roads means land-based commutes to the city center will require some planning.

The district is a mix of residential and recreational character, with an emphasis on open space and community living. Twenty parks and eight religious sites contribute to a relaxed, green-focused environment. The area is still developing, as evidenced by the lack of heavy construction activity, and the low-rise, horizontal layout suggests a slower-paced, community-driven lifestyle. It’s not a high-density commercial area but rather a balanced suburb with a focus on well-being and accessibility.
